Letter from Fr. Michael O'Flanagan to George Noble Plunkett, Count Plunkett, containing a list of priests,

1917 April 5.
Bibliographic Details
Main Creator: O'Flanagan, Michael, 1876-1942
Contributors: Plunkett, George Noble, Count, 1851-1948
Summary:In this letter Fr. Michael O'Flanagan recommends James Joseph O'Kelly as the best man to put forward because he will [agree] to the abstention policy.
